How to register your business as GST Registered in RetailEasy7?

In the case of registered GST suppliers, they have the legal right to provide goods or services to their clients and collect tax from them. They can also credit their clients for the tax they paid on the goods and services they provide.

 

Purpose of GST Registered Supplier in RetailEasy7:

When you register GST in RetailEasy7, your purchase invoices and sales bills will include GST based on the product tax percentage.

A Guide to register under GST in RetailEasy7:

Step 1: Navigate to Tools -> Masters -> Registration.

 

 

 

Step 2:

  1. Choose Regular as the registration type and click register to continue.

  2. Click yes, I agree and continue after you have read the terms and conditions.

 

 

 

 

Step 3: To verify, navigate to Sales -> Sales bill.

 

 


Step 4: If you choose a product, you'll see that the GST amount for this billing transaction is entered in the sales bill screen.

 

 

By using this method, you can register in GST, and if you wish to change to unregistered GST, you should follow the same steps, selecting unregistered under registration type.
